T H (Taa Haa)
135 verses, revealed in Mecca after Mary (Maryam) before The Inevitable (Al-Waaqe'ah)
In the name of God, the Most Gracious, the Most Merciful
۞ TA HA. 1 We did not reveal the Qur'an to you to cause you distress; 2 but as a reminder to he who fears. 3 a revelation from Him who has created the earth and the high heavens 4 the Most Gracious, established on the throne of His almightiness? 5 To Him belongs all that is in the heavens and the earth, all that lies between them, and lies below the earth. 6 And if thou speakest the word aloud, then verily He knoweth the secret and the most hidden. 7 Allah! there is no god but He! To Him belong the most Beautiful Names. 8 And has the story of Moses reached you? - 9 Lo! he saw a fire [in the desert]; and so he said to his family: "Wait here! Behold, I perceive a fire [far away]: perhaps I can bring you a brand there from, or find at the fire some guidance." 10 But when he came to the fire, a voice was heard: "O Moses! 11 "Verily I am thy Lord! therefore (in My presence) put off thy shoes: thou art in the sacred valley Tuwa. 12 And I have chosen thee, so hearken unto that which is inspired. 13 Indeed, I am Allah. There is no god except Me. Worship Me, and establish the prayer of My remembrance. 14 Lo! the Hour is surely coming. But I will to keep it hidden, that every soul may be rewarded for that which it striveth (to achieve). 15 "Therefore, let not the one who believes not therein (i.e. in the Day of Resurrection, Reckoning, Paradise and Hell, etc.), but follows his own lusts, divert you therefrom, lest you perish. 16 And what is in your right hand, O Moses?" 17 He replied, "It is my staff. I lean on it, bring down leaves for my sheep with it and I need it for other reasons. 18 [Allah] said, "Throw it down, O Moses." 19 Moses threw it on the ground and suddenly he saw that it was a moving serpent. 20 He said: Grasp it and fear not. We shall return it to its former state. 21 And place your hand in your armpit, it will come forth shining white, without blemish. This is another Sign of Allah, 22 "In order that We may show thee (two) of our Greater Signs. 23 Go to Pharaoh; he has transgressed all bounds." 24
